#686174 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#686174 is composed of 40.8% red, 38%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.3% cyan, 16.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 262.1 degrees, a saturation of 8.9% and a lightness of 41.8%. #686174 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0c2e8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#686174 color description : Dark grayish violet.
#686174 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#686174 has RGB values of R:104, G:97,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 6840692.

Shades and Tints of #686174
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080809 is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#686174
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a696c is the less saturated color, while #5007ce is the most saturated one.
